Ridgeline Trust

Ridgeline Trust is a small local charity which is aiming to help people with mental and physical disabilities regain lost skills, learn new skills, and rebuild confidence and self-esteem in the context of a therapeutic wildlife garden in East Reading.

Reading Borough Council kindly agreed to lease us this land at a peppercorn (or nominal) rent.

 
Ridgeline Trust believes that for people with mental and/or physical disabilities, learning difficulties and other special needs, time spent in the natural environment, with the support of volunteers from the local community, can help towards rebuilding their lives.
 
Park United Reformed Church has supported the Ridgeline Trust with voluntary work carried out by the FIZZANG youth club and with finiancial support. In December 2011, over £450 was donated to support the Ridgeline Trust.
